Health
Yorkies are intelligent and tolerant dogs that love to be pampered. They are hypoallergenic and don't require much exercise, which makes them an ideal pet for people who live in apartments. Their terrier heritage is perceived as a strong protection instinct and an obstinate streak. If they're not socialized properly as puppies, they may not get well with other dogs, and they may be jealous and possessive of their owners.
These dogs have a small bladder, and aren't always able to give clear signals when they need to go. This can lead to accidents in the home, making it essential to be present most of the time to keep an eye on.
They are also susceptible to dental disease because of their small mouths and their teeth. Daily brushing with pet-specific toothpaste, as well regular dental cleanings under anesthesia, are crucial to prevent disease and keep your dog healthy.
Yorkshire Terriers from Yorkshire are generally in good health condition, but they are susceptible to certain illnesses and conditions. They could develop cataracts, liver shunts, hypoglycemia (low blood sugar) and musculoskeletal issues.
A healthy diet, training, vet care, enrichment and plenty of opportunities to chase squeaky mice are essential for your Yorkie to live a long, healthy and fulfilled life.
Legg-Calve-Perthes is a condition that can affect small dogs, like Yorkies. The femoral heads on the hip bones are brittle and they are susceptible to breaking because there is a decrease in blood flow to the region. LCP can cause pain and lameness in both rear legs and requires surgery.
Heart disease is a different health issue. Yorkies, as well as other breeds of toys are at greater risk of cardiovascular disease due to their small bodies. A high-quality, low-fat diet of vegetables and meat can reduce the risk.
